Mr. Brown associated with the Firm in 1985 and became a Firm Officer in 1991.
He focuses his practice primarily in the areas of commercial and real estate litigation, ad valorem tax and property valuation litigation. Mr. Brown serves as legal counsel for the Galveston Central Appraisal District and the Port of Galveston. He has litigated hundreds of cases concerning appraised value and property tax exemption issues. He also serves as local claims counsel for Stewart Title Guaranty Company. Mr. Brown also advises and represents a variety of other Firm clients on commercial/real estate litigation and property tax issues.
Community
Galveston Independent School District Trustee, District 4-D
